($1,522) Cost to ship a car from Austin, TX to Bridgeport, CT
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 1,811 miles from Austin, Texas, to Bridgeport, Connecticut, ranges from $1,522 to $2,211. Costs vary depending on factors like the type of vehicle, transport method, and time of year.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ies
We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.
Here’s what we considered:
-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
-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
-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
-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
-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.
Car shipping alternatives from TX to CT
Getting your car from Austin to Bridgeport can be done in a few different ways. Here’s a breakdown of your top car shipping options that highlights their advantages and drawbacks.
Coordinate with your movers
When relocating from Austin to Bridgeport, most of the top-rated moving companies can bundle auto transport into your move by partnering with national car shippers. The trade-off is convenience versus flexibility, since you’ll be tied to their carrier of choice and rates.
Drive your car
Choosing whether to drive or ship your vehicle involves trade-offs. The 1,811 miles from Austin to Bridgeport might make for an enjoyable road trip and save you money. But the downsides include added wear on your car and potential risks from weather or long-distance driving.
Use a driving service
Having a driver transport your car from Texas to Connecticut is also an option, but it doesn’t come cheap. You’ll need to trust that the driver can deliver your car safely from Austin to Bridgeport. Plus, the trip inevitably adds wear and mileage to your vehicle.
Ship your car via train
For a budget-friendly and reliable option, consider shipping your car by train to Bridgeport. It’s actually the least expensive way to transport a vehicle. The trade-off is slower delivery and more limited pickup and drop-off points compared to other methods.
Factors affecting Austin to Bridgeport car shipping costs
If you’re moving your car from Austin to Bridgeport, the cost will depend on several key factors:
Transport method
There are a few ways to ship your car from Austin to Bridgeport, including open carriers, enclosed shipping, or top-loaded service. Your best bet depends on your priorities.
Open carriers are the cheapest option, while enclosed shipping is best for safeguarding luxury or classic vehicles. If you’re unsure which transport type fits your move to Bridgeport, our comparison guide can help.
Vehicle size and type
Your shipping costs out of Austin will be determined in large part by what kind of car you have. As you might guess, the bigger the vehicle, the more it will cost. This is simply because it takes up more space and adds more weight to the carrier. So, a full-size SUV will be more expensive to ship to Bridgeport than a compact car.
Distance and route
Basically, longer distances mean higher shipping prices. Extra miles drive up fuel usage, labor hours, tolls, and maintenance costs. So moving your car 1,811 miles from Austin to Bridgeport will almost always cost more than a shorter in-state trip in Texas.
Location also affects the cost. Shipments along common interstate routes are typically cheaper, while hard-to-reach destinations add to the price.
The time of the year
Seasonal demand and weather conditions in both Austin and Bridgeport can impact car shipping prices.
Austin has mild winters and hot summers, the rainiest months are typically May, June, and October so your move may be affected in these months.
Bridgeport has long, hot summers, and cool to cold winters, with precipitation spread fairly evenly throughout the year.
During peak moving times like summer and the winter holidays, demand for car shipping services increases, leading to higher prices. Shipping your car from Austin to Bridgeport during these peak seasons can result in higher costs.
Fuel prices
Fluctuating fuel prices are one of the biggest elements affecting car shipping costs. On the 1,811-mile drive between Austin and Bridgeport, even small changes at the pump can make a difference. When fuel rates rise, so do shipping charges.
Delivery expectations
Auto shippers sometimes offer reduced rates if you’re open to flexible delivery dates. On average, shipping from Austin to Bridgeport takes three to eleven days. Opting for flexibility can save you money, but expedited service provides quicker transport at an added cost.
Comparing Austin and Bridgeport vehicle regulations
Parking permits
- Austin: If you are temporarily loading or unloading non-construction materials or if you need to place a temporary storage device in the right of way, you will need a parking permit.
- Bridgeport: A contractor with a small pick-up truck that is hired by City residents to pick up household or landscaping items must be licensed with the City of Bridgeport. For more information on what licensing entails, please contact this office at 203-576-7790
Car insurance requirements
- Austin: Every driver in Texas is mandated to have liability insurance known as 30/60/25 coverage. However, this minimum requirement may fall short in adequately covering the aftermath of a moderately severe accident. The basic policy offers $30,000 for individual injury coverage, up to $60,000 for injury coverage per accident, and provides up to $25,000 for property damage.
- Bridgeport: The basic car insurance requirements in the state of Connecticut is as follow: Bodily injury liability: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ident Property damage liability: $25,000 per accident Uninsured/underinsured motorist: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ident
Vehicle inspections
- Austin: In Texas, vehicles undergo annual safety inspections covering brakes, lights, steering, tires, etc. Some qualify for a two-year cycle.
- Bridgeport: In Connecticut, all vehicles must undergo an emissions inspection every two years, with a few exceptions. Additionally, a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) inspection, which confirms the vehicle's identity, is required when registering the vehicle in the state.
Driver’s license
- Austin: New residents are required to obtain a Texas driver license from the Texas Department of Public Safety within 90 days of moving to the state.
- Bridgeport: As a new resident of Connecticut, you must obtain a Connecticut driver's license within 30 days. Residency is defined as living in the state for over 6 months in a year.
FAQ
How much does it cost to ship a car from Austin to Bridgeport?
The cost to ship a car from Austin, TX to Bridgeport, CT varies based on several factors, including the type of transport (open vs. enclosed car shipping), vehicle size and weight, and the current fuel prices. On average, transporting your vehicle from Austin to Bridgeport will range from $1,522 to $2,211.
How long will it take to ship my car from Austin to Bridgeport?
It will take approximately three to eleven days to ship your car the 1,811 miles from Austin to Bridgeport. If you need it quicker, ask your shipper about expedited delivery.
What’s the cheapest way to ship my car from Austin to Bridgeport?
An open-transport car carrier is the cheapest way to ship your car from Austin to Bridgeport. However, there are other methods. Read our post on the cheapest way to ship a car to learn more.
Is it cheaper to ship my car or drive it from Austin to Bridgeport?
It is generally cheaper to drive your car from Austin to Bridgeport than to ship it. However, when deciding whether to drive your car or ship it, you need to factor in related costs like maintenance fees that could result from the additional wear-and-tear on your vehicle during the 1,811-mile trip. Long-distance trips also involve food and possibly lodging, which can add up quickly.
